Sevilla The City Of Contrasting History - Spain`s Largest City Bathed In Light And Moorish Architecture. The Famous Alcazar Made Of Both Arabic And Victorian Themes. Photo
© Saunderstls | Stock Free Images
Pro Stock Photos From Dreamstime
Similar Free Images